The effects and methods of washing the nose with saline solution

As urban air problems become increasingly serious, more and more people are beginning to develop various respiratory diseases, and those with rhinitis will have more severe symptoms. In order to protect our own health and prevent physical illness caused by air problems, it is recommended to develop a scientific method of washing the nose with saline solution to ensure that the nose remains in an orderly working state.

1. The role of saline nasal washing

1. Sterilization: The bactericidal effect of warm salt water can kill bacteria and allergens in the nasal cavity. Eliminating germs helps to relieve inflammation symptoms.

2. Help restore the nasal cavity environment: The temperature and concentration of warm saline are similar to those of human body fluids, which can effectively help the nasal cavity return to its normal physiological environment. The frequency of the pulsating water flow is close to the normal oscillation frequency of the nasal cilia, which can gradually help the nasal cilia resume normal oscillation.

3. Clean the nasal cavity: Use water to flush out scabs (commonly known as nasal mucus) and secretions that block the nostrils directly from the nasal cavity, making the nasal cavity unobstructed and breathing smooth.

4. Soothe nasal muscles: Pulsating water massage can soothe nasal muscles and improve nasal blood circulation.

5. Repair edema: Normal saline can play a good role in repairing the swelling and edema of nasal tissue, thereby eliminating swelling and edema and effectively relieving nasal congestion symptoms.

2. How to wash your nose with saline

The method of washing your nose with saline is very important. First, you need to choose the right tools, and secondly, you need to master the concentration and temperature of the saline. The specific steps are as follows:

Preparation tools: empty bottle with spray function; 0.9% saline solution;

Specific steps:

1. Heat the saline solution in an electric cup until it is warm enough to touch but not too hot.

2. Then pour the heated saline solution into the empty bottle of the spray and screw it shut;

3. Just spray it directly into your nose. The saline solution flows through the nasal vestibule (the part of the nose that sticks out of the head), sinuses, and nasal passages, around the nasopharynx, and then out of one nostril or out of the mouth.

4. Spray four or five times a day, 2-3 sprays each time. Of course, the more times you use it, the better the effect. Spray more each time you use it.
